How Sewer Pipe Relining Experts help you Avoid Winter Plumbing Problems

  1. Unfortunately, sewer problems don’t take the colder seasons off. In fact, extreme weather conditions can take an even greater toll on sewers than warm weather does. So we suggest you take steps to ensure your sewer system remains in top shape. Here are ways your sewer pipe relining in Sydney professionals can help you prevent winter plumbing problems.
    1. CCTV Pipe Inspection – Plumbing situations are unpredictable and can be aggravating especially when it happens during extreme weather conditions when repairs can be difficult. If you don’t want to find yourself in a plumbing situation during the blustery days, we recommend getting a CCTV pipe inspection. With our pipe cameras, we can have a close look at the interior of the pipe to examine any forms of defects before it can even turn into something much more costly and disruptive. Take for example tree roots. You will never know roots are growing in your sewer lines unless a plumber feeds through a camera and find this out for you or you start to notice episodes of a blocked drain. Roots not cleared in time can produce leaks in pipes and eventually collapse.

    1. Blocked sewer clearing – Blockages can affect your house’s plumbing system in a variety of ways, much more during winter when it is more likely to increase the chances of a burst pipe and even sewage backup. During harsh weather months, grease and oil washed down can harden and add up to the blockage that could probably be already present in your sewer line. Therefore, along with pipe inspection, blocked sewer clearing is much-needed maintenance you should consider. Clearing blockages in pipes no matter how you think it’s minimal can mean so much over time in your home. This can help you prevent potentially expensive repairs caused by blockages.

    1. Leak Detection – As we move into the thick of the winter, the chances of running into pipe problems increase. Leaking pipes for example can be one of the problems that could crop up if the passageway for water becomes blocked due to freezing wastewater or sewages within your plumbing placing an overwhelming amount of stress on the pipes and causing cracks and gaps. Apart from camera inspection, sewer relining contractors like Revolution Pipe Relining can also find out if there’s a leak in your pipeline through different leak tests. If we determine a leak in the sewer line is present, we can provide you with different options to fix it without causing disruption to your property.

Top 3 Sewer Problems Your Home Is Susceptible to During Cold Weather

         Sewer Leaks – Your sewer lines may be lying underneath your feet but they are not resistant to cold weather problems. Heavy snow and harsh weather can cause sewer lines to crack, especially when it has a buildup that is not addressed. Pipe joints could also loosen and become misaligned.

          Tree Root Issues – During the cold months of the year, one would think that tree roots become lazy, but they’re wrong. Instead, they continue to look for sources of moisture underground and deeper to thrive. For tree roots, the warm water flowing through the sewer lines is a lifesaver, therefore they’re attracted to it. A thorough sewer inspection can determine if thirsty tree roots have found their way into your sewer lines.

          Blocked Sewer Lines – Sewer pipes are typically made of either copper or PVC materials that expand and contract when exposed to temperature changes. Considering the effects of cold temperatures on pipes in mind, it’s safe to say that if your sewer pipes are subjected to winter weather, the sewage waste inside can expand because it freezes. Along with the high chance that your pipe can contract when it’s cold, this can spell disaster. If the sewer pipe bursts to the point that it is beyond repair, you will need to completely replace it.
